Category Landscape

AI platforms recommend parking spot finder apps by synthesizing real-time data, pricing structures, and user reviews. Unlike traditional SEO, AI visibility in this category depends on the platform's ability to parse structured data regarding inventory and geographic coverage. ChatGPT and Gemini prioritize apps with deep API integrations or extensive web-based reservation systems. Perplexity focuses on local citations and recent news regarding city-specific partnerships. Claude tends to evaluate apps based on user experience reports and feature sets like EV charging availability or monthly subscription options. Brands that maintain consistent data across third-party aggregators and local business listings see the highest recommendation frequency in conversational search.

How do AI models determine which parking app is the most reliable?

AI models assess reliability by analyzing a combination of app store ratings, third-party technical reviews, and user discussions on platforms like Reddit or travel forums. They look for consistent mentions of successful reservations and minimal technical glitches. Brands that maintain a high volume of positive, recent citations across diverse web sources are prioritized as the most trustworthy options for users seeking a stress-free experience.

Does having more parking locations improve my AI visibility?

Quantity of locations is a significant factor, but density in high-demand urban areas matters more. AI models like Gemini and Perplexity look for the 'best' solution for a specific coordinate. If your app has the most inventory in a high-traffic zone like Midtown Manhattan, you are more likely to be the primary recommendation for queries centered on that specific geographic location.

Can AI models see real-time parking availability in my app?

Most AI models do not have direct real-time access to your private database yet. However, they crawl public-facing reservation pages and API documentation. By exposing real-time availability through structured data or public endpoints, you increase the likelihood that an AI will confidently state that a spot is available now, rather than providing a generic recommendation of your service.

Why is my app mentioned for street parking but not for garages?

This usually stems from how your content is categorized and cited online. If your brand is frequently mentioned in news articles about municipal contracts or street meters, AI will categorize you as a 'on-street' specialist. To shift this, you must create and promote content specifically around garage partnerships, indoor security features, and pre-booking benefits to re-train the model's association with your brand.

How does the rise of EV charging change parking app visibility?

EV charging is becoming a primary filter for parking searches. AI models now specifically look for apps that can filter for 'Level 2' or 'DC Fast Charging.' If your metadata doesn't explicitly highlight charging infrastructure within your parking facilities, you will lose visibility for the rapidly growing segment of electric vehicle owners who use AI to plan their stops and charging sessions.

Do AI platforms prefer apps with direct booking or third-party aggregators?

AI platforms generally prefer direct booking capabilities because they provide a more seamless user journey. If an AI can tell a user 'you can book this right now for $20,' it provides a better experience than saying 'this app helps you find spots.' Direct integration via plugins or clear call-to-action buttons on your site helps AI models confirm your booking utility.

How important are local city guides for AI parking recommendations?

City guides are essential for building topical authority. When you publish a guide on 'The 10 Best Places to Park Near Fenway Park,' you provide the AI with a semantic map of your inventory. This content helps the model understand that your app is a relevant solution for a specific event or landmark, increasing your visibility when users ask event-specific questions.

Will my app be recommended if it requires a subscription?

AI models will still recommend subscription-based apps, but they often prioritize free-to-use or pay-per-use models for general queries. If your app has a subscription, ensure your content clearly explains the value proposition, such as 'save 30% on daily rates.' This allows the AI to recommend your app specifically to 'frequent commuters' or 'budget-conscious users' who would benefit most from that model.
